BLURB
Paimon is gone, and Carmella’s
obligation to the djinn is over, so why does the world feel a little bleaker?
There’s barely time to ponder before a horrific massacre leaves her in charge
of her first case with the IEPEU. Under the watchful eye of Murdoch, the
organisation's top investigator, and with the help of her friends, Urvashi,
Honey, and Banner, Carmella must uncover the identity of the supernatural
creatures behind the attack and expose the person pulling their strings.
Cut off from the skein by a coven
ruling, and under attack, Carmella is defenceless until her asura power surges
to the surface revealing her true nature. Confronted with the full force of her
power, and afraid of losing control, Carmella reluctantly turns to Vritra for
guidance.
The Serpent dragon demi-god is more
than happy to help if it means bringing her into the fold and convincing her
that Shaitan Enterprises is where she truly belongs. With Vritra’s guidance,
Carmella must quickly learn to master a power bigger than she could ever have
anticipated. Because Carmella is on a hit list, and the person that wants her
dead will do anything to uncover her weaknesses, except this time Carmella
won’t be taken by surprise. This time she’s not going down without a fight.

Author Info
Debbie Cassidy lives
in England, Bedfordshire, with her three kids and very supportive husband.
Coffee and chocolate biscuits are her writing fuels of choice, and she is still
working on getting that perfect tower of solitude built in her back garden.
Obsessed with building new worlds and reading about them, she spends her spare
time daydreaming and conversing with the characters in her head – in a totally
non psychotic way of course. She writes High Fantasy, Urban Fantasy and Science
Fiction. Debbie also writes dark, diverse Urban Fantasy fiction, under the pen
name Amos Cassidy, with her best friend Richard Amos.
